Data for proton transport through atomic hydrogen environments: Elastic scattering 质子在氢原子环境中传输的数据:弹性散射
IF 1.8 3区 物理与天体物理 Q2 PHYSICS, ATOMIC, MOLECULAR & CHEMICAL Pub Date : 2023-07-10 DOI: 10.1016/j.adt.2023.101601
D.R. Schultz , R. Wang , P.C. Stancil , N.D. Cariatore

Spanning the center-of-mass energy range of 10−4 to 108eV, presented here are recommended integral and differential cross sections for elastic scattering in collisions of protons with atomic hydrogen. The recommended values have been determined by analysis of results of three primary theoretical methods with overlapping regimes of applicability within this broad range of collision energies. With comparison to data available in the literature and study of the numerical and physical convergences of the calculations, uncertainty quantification of the results has been made, which in turn aids uncertainty quantification of the astrophysical and other environment simulations the data is aimed at enabling. Along with other data for processes including excitation, ionization, and charge transfer, the present data support improved transport modeling of the passage of protons through atomic hydrogen, describing energy loss, charge change, secondary electron production, and photon emission.

Energy levels and radiative transition properties of the 2s2p double K-shell vacancy state in He-like ions (4≤Z≤54) 类he离子(4≤Z≤54)中2s2p双k壳空位态的能级和辐射跃迁性质

The energy levels of 1s2, 1s2s, and 2s2p configurations for He-like ions (4Z54) are calculated using the multi-configuration Dirac–Hartree–Fock​ methods. The transition energies, transition rates, and oscillator strengths of 2s2p1s2 and 2s2p1s2s are also calculated. A parallel calculation based on the Dirac–Fock–Slater method with a local central potential is performed using the Flexible Atomic Code to cross-check the accuracy of the data. The Breit interaction and quantum electrodynamics effects, including self-energy and vacuum polarization, are included as perturbations in these calculations. The average relative standard deviation of the energy levels from the available NIST data is about 0.2% for both methods. The transition energies and rates are in reasonable agreement with other available theoretical and experimental data, and the consistency between the transition energies calculated by the two methods reaches 99.9%. These results are expected to help future investigations on double K-shell vacancy decays of He-like ions.

Assessment of Maize Silage Quality under Different Pre-Ensiling Conditions 不同预青贮条件下玉米青贮品质评价

Maize silage suffers from several factors that affect the final quality and, to some extent, pre-ensiled conditions that can be potentially tuned during harvesting. After assessing new indices for silage quality under lab-scale conditions, several trials have been conducted to find associations between fresh maize characteristics and silage features. Among the first, we included field input levels, FAO class, maturity stage, use of bacterial inoculants, sealing delay and chemical traits, whereas, among the latter, we assessed density and porosity, pH, fermentative profile, dry matter loss and aerobic stability. The trials were conducted using vacuum bags or mini silo buckets. More than 1500 maize samples harvested in Northeast Italy were analysed during the 2016–2022 period. Moreover, to evaluate silage aerobic stability, the fermentative profile and temperature were measured 14 days after the opening of the silo. The association between silage quality and aerobic stability was assessed, and a prognostic risk score was used to calculate the probability of aerobic instability. The dataset could provide baseline information to promote the continuous improvement of maize silage management from different botanical and crop fields, thus improving agronomic and animal farm resource allocation from a precision agriculture perspective.

Systematics of log ft values for β−, and EC/β+ transitions β−和EC/β+跃迁的log ft值系统

This work is an update of the 1998 publication by Singh et al. [1] and reviews the log ft values for all the known β-decay branches (β−, β+/EC). Furthermore, an update of all Q-values (from AME2020  [2]), as well as a recalculation of all the log ft values (through BetaShape code [3], [4]) has been conducted using relevant data in the ENSDF database, as well as in newer literature. Only those cases have been considered in this review, where the beta transitions occur between levels of firm single spin assignments (86% of the transitions), and with probable single spin assignments (14% of the transitions), but with firm parity assignments for all the transitions. Weak β branches of <1% intensity in complex decay schemes have generally been omitted. Out of a total of 26 318 β transitions extracted from the ENSDF database and current literature, data for only 4038 β transitions survived the filtering criteria in the present review. The log ft values in β decay, spanning about 21 orders of magnitude, have been classified into allowed and forbidden categories according to the classification scheme of Konopinski [5]. All log ft values have been deduced using the BetaShape code with new developments presented in this study. A very few number of log ft values for very low-energy beta transitions (<5 keV) survived the cut criteria and are briefly discussed in terms of atomic overlap corrections. Also tabulated and briefly discussed are seven superallowed cases with ΔT = 0, Tz(parent) = −2, while a known case for 28S to 28P has been omitted as reliable EC/β+feeding to the analog state in 28P cannot be assigned due to lack of adequate experimental and detailed data for this decay. Centroid, width, minimum and maximum values for each category have been deduced. Uncertainties have been estimated and are also given. For literature coverage in the present review, see discussion in text.

Pre-neutron emission average total kinetic energy of fission fragments 裂变碎片的中子前发射平均总动能

A new expression for a calculation of the pre-neutron emission average total kinetic energy of fission fragments (TKE), which takes into account the dependence of TKE on both Z2/A1/3 and the excitation energy of the fissioning nuclei, is found using the 728 experimental values of the TKE. These 728 values of TKE for 115 fissioning nuclei with the numbers of proton and nucleons in the ranges 48Z120 and 78A302 are measured by various experimental groups in different reactions at various excitation energies of the fissioning nuclei. The dependence of the TKE on the excitation energy of the fissioning nuclei is clearly shown for many nuclei. The account of the excitation energy dependence of the TKE leads to the smallest value of the root-mean-square deviation between the experimental and theoretical TKE values.

Theoretical investigation of Sb-like sequence: Sb I, Te II, I III, Xe IV, and Cs V 类Sb序列Sb I、Te II、iiii、Xe IV、Cs V的理论研究

We aim to investigate atomic properties of Sb-like sequence: Sb I, Te II, I III, Xe IV, and Cs V. The multiconfiguration Dirac–Hartree–Fock and relativistic configuration interaction methods, which are implemented in the general-purpose relativistic atomic structure package GRASP2018, are used in the present work. The lowest energy levels of the 5s25p3, 5s5p4, 5p5, 5s5p35d, and 5s25p2{6s,7s,6p,7p,5d,6d,4f} configurations and electric dipole, magnetic dipole, and electric quadrupole transitions between states of these configurations are computed. Accuracy of energy levels are evaluated by comparing it with the National Institute of Standards and Technology Atomic Spectra Database recommended values and with other methods. Accuracy of transitions data are investigated using quantitative and qualitative evaluation method.

Factory-Based Vibration Data for Bearing-Fault Detection 基于工厂振动数据的轴承故障检测

The importance of preventing failures in bearings has led to a large amount of research being conducted to find methods for fault diagnostics and prognostics. Many of these solutions, such as deep learning methods, require a significant amount of data to perform well. This is a reason why publicly available data are important, and there currently exist several open datasets that contain different conditions and faults. However, one challenge is that almost all of these data come from a laboratory setting, where conditions might differ from those found in an industrial environment where the methods are intended to be used. This also means that there may be characteristics of the industrial data that are important to take into account. Therefore, this study describes a completely new dataset for bearing faults from a pulp mill. The analysis of the data shows that the faults vary significantly in terms of fault development, rotation speed, and the amplitude of the vibration signal. It also suggests that methods built for this environment need to consider that no historical examples of faults in the target domain exist and that external events can occur that are not related to any condition of the bearing.
